1) Incorrect default permissions

EUVDB-ID: #VU54142

Risk: Low

CVSSv3.1: 5.8 [CVSS:3.1/AV:L/AC:H/PR:L/UI:R/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H/E:U/RL:O/RC:C]

CVE-ID: CVE-2021-0100

CWE-ID: CWE-276 - Incorrect Default Permissions

Exploit availability: No

Description

The vulnerability allows a local user to escalate privileges on the system.

The vulnerability exists due to incorrect default permissions in the installer. A local user can gain elevated privileges on the target system.

Mitigation

Install update from vendor's website released 12/31/2020.

Vulnerable software versions

Intel SSD Data Center Tool: All versions
